They also do not represent the views of the OECD or the IMF and the governments they represent. 3 Handbook ON Measuring Digital Trade OECD 2020 Foreword In response to growing demand for coherent and comparable data on Digital Trade , in 2017 the Inter-Agency Task Force on International Trade Statistics created an Expert Group, drawn from international organisations, national statistics agencies and central banks, to develop a Handbook that provided: A conceptual framework to define Digital Trade , around which national efforts could be targeted;and A mechanism to bring together and share existing national and international efforts on measuringdigital Trade and/or dimensions of it, that could be used to identify and develop best present Handbook reflects the outcome to date of the Expert Group s efforts.
